What to look for

What to consider

Start by deciding between powder and capsule formats. Powders are more versatile for mixing into drinks and often provide higher doses per serving. Capsules are convenient for travel and those who dislike flavored supplements. Look for a product that lists all nine EAA doses explicitly rather than hiding them in a proprietary blend. Verify that leucine content is at least 2 to 3 grams per serving for meaningful muscle protein synthesis support. Third-party testing certifications such as NSF Certified for Sport or Informed Sport verify that what is on the label is in the product. Avoid products with excessive added sugars, artificial dyes, or an unusually long additive list.

FAQs

What is the difference between a complete amino acid supplement and a BCAA supplement?

'A complete amino acid supplement provides all nine essential amino acids (EAAs) the body cannot produce on its own, including leucine, isoleucine, valine, lysine, methionine, phenylalanine, threonine, tryptophan, and histidine. A BCAA supplement contains only the three branched-chain amino acids: leucine, isoleucine, and valine. For muscle protein synthesis and recovery, a full EAA profile is more effective than BCAAs alone. Consult a healthcare professional before use if you have kidney or liver conditions.'

When is the best time to take a complete amino acid supplement?

For muscle recovery, taking a complete amino acid supplement within 30 minutes before or after training is a common approach. For general daily protein support, consistent timing matters more than the specific window. Some users take them between meals to maintain elevated amino acid levels throughout the day. Consult a healthcare professional before use to determine the protocol that fits your health status and training goals.
